Chromebox, which is a small form-factor PC first introduced by Samsung in May 2012. Chromebase, an ” all-in-one ” desktop PC was introduced by LG Electronics in January 2014. Chromebits, also known as stick PCs were introduced by Asus in April 2015.
What is the history of Chromebooks in India?
Lenovo, Hewlett Packard and Google itself entered the market in early 2013. In December 2013, Samsung launched a Samsung Chromebook specifically for the Indian market that employed the company’s Exynos 5 Dual core processor.
By January 2013, Acer’s Chromebook sales were being driven by ” heavy Internet users with educational institutions “, and the platform represented 5–10 percent of the company’s US shipments, according to Acer president Jim Wong. He called those numbers sustainable, contrasting them with low Windows 8 sales which he blamed for a slump in the market.
What is a Chromebook?
A Chromebook (sometimes stylized in lowercase as chromebook) is a laptop or tablet running the Linux -based Chrome OS as its operating system. Chromebooks are used to perform a variety of tasks using the Google Chrome browser and, since 2017, can also run Android apps.

Who makes Acer laptops?
Acer laptops computers are made by Acer incorporated. A multinational electronics and IT company. The company was founded by Stan Shih along with his wife and friends and they called it Multitech then. Multitech wasn’t into the business or creating computers but instead it focused on creating semiconductors and other electronic parts.
